Profile
Bucto National High School is a recognized TESDA Assessment Center committed to delivering quality technical-vocational education and competency assessment services in its local community. As an accredited assessment venue, the school plays a vital role in bridging academic learning with industry-ready skills, enabling students and community members to earn nationally recognized qualifications. The institution supports the Philippine government’s thrust of developing a globally competitive workforce by providing accessible and credible competency assessments aligned with TESDA’s Training Regulations. Bucto National High School serves not only its enrolled students but also out-of-school youth, workers, and community members seeking formal recognition of their technical skills. By integrating technical-vocational tracks into its curriculum, the school prepares learners for immediate employment or entrepreneurship upon graduation. Its assessment services ensure that candidates are evaluated against industry standards, making them competitive in both local and overseas job markets. The school stands as an important pillar of TVET delivery at the secondary level, fostering a culture of skills development and lifelong learning.
